Superhero comics first started with a superhero named The Phantom who appeared in newspaper comic strips but they became popular once full comic books started with DC Comics creation of Superman.
The most famous comic companies are DC, Marvel and Dark-Horse who have lots of characters, places and objects of importance to those fictional series.
The jobs in the comic industry include the artist who draws the images, the writer who scripts the stories editors who check the story, marketing and sales department who try and advertise the comics so people will buy them. There are also the legal team who make sure no copyright problems will happen and partner companies who do things like special crossovers and create movies, TV shows and video games of the characters.
Characters usually have very well known origins, allies, teams and enemies. The most famous characters include Batman, Spider-Man, Superman, The Joker, Lex Luthor, Iron Man etc.
There job is to create stories that entertain the people who buy them threw comedy, story lines, entertaining scenarios, drama and emotions.

Media: Video Games
Video games started out as simple things like a 0's and X's and a space shooter on a radar but video games didn't start properly until the arcade game Pong (a table tennis-like game with multiplayer).
Video game mascots (famous and popular characters) first started after Pac-Man appeared and then when video games started loosing audience Mario was created by Nintendo to save the gaming industry and it has evolved since then.
The most well known gaming companies include Nintendo, Sega, Sony, Microsoft, Namco, Capcom, Konami etc.
The jobs in gaming include the graphics designer who makes the stuff for the game like objects and characters, artists who draw artwork for the game, testers who make sure the game works, the director who makes sure the game is what it is supposed to be and game shop employees who sell the games.
The characters usually have power-ups or weapons and maybe vehicles. The most famous of video game characters include Mario, Link, Pikachu, Master Chief, Crash Bandicoot, Pac-Man, Mega Man, Sonic and many more.
A video games purpose is to let you play through fictional things that you wouldn't be able to do in real life, they can also have stories that make you care about the characters and horror games are there to scare you.
DC Comics makes comics obviously but they also do animated series, movies, tv shows, cartoons and other things. They advertise all of these things usually with video trailers but they also do posters and billboards.
DC posters usually have the main heroes and villains on the cover with the actors names somewhere near. The posters usually use dark colours for the background and includes the date of release at the bottom and the title at the top or in the middle.
The audience of the poster are fans of Batman, DC Comics or superheroes in general, although people who are fans of an actor might also go and watch the movies. The poster uses cool images of the well known heroes and villains with background using the hero symbols or the city and sometimes both. They also use the dark background with the brighter characters on top of it.

DC trailers take clips from the show, movie or game combining parts of the plot, they use mostly action but a little bit of humour in order to show us how entertaining the movie will be.
Fans of Wonder Woman, DC Comics or female superheroes would be most of the audience although if someone is a fan of the actor they may also go. The trailers use the same dark background with brighter characters, the action and humour combined to make people want to watch the movies.
Marvel, Like DC is a comic book company that also do movies and other media.

The posters to marvel movies like The Avengers always have the main characters in cool poses with some background like a city with explosions happening.
Fans of superhero team ups, Marvel or the famous actors will go to watch the movie.
The marvel video trailers use a lot of humour to make you know the movies are funny so we will want to watch them, they also show off the characters and a bit of plot along with some action.
The actors names are a long the top to show what famous actors are in the movie to make people want to come for the good acting.
Fans of marvel, superheroes or the actors would go to the movie but the movie is also about outcasts and is a comedy so fans of comedies and outcast characters would also go to see the movie.
The Marvel movies use a lot more humour than DC which uses more plot stuff and action in there adverts and trailers. There posters however are both almost the same, with similar techniques like the characters and the actor names.

This billboard is advertising a video game called Fallout.
The target audience is gamers and fallout fans.
The billboard has the games title and release date and also the games mascot doing his iconic thumbs up, wink.
The board is simple but the reason it is appealing is because you can see the big bold text saying the name of the game and also shows you the character mascot that makes you want to play the game.
The writing is big and bold but in the iconic series font that the game is known for.

This billboard is advertising the movie Deadpool.
The target audience is marvel fans and movie fans that are old enough to go to the movie.
The Billboard shows when it will be in cinemas and used funny icons to spell out the name of the movie.
The billboard is appealing because it uses deadpool's humour.
The billboard uses simple easy to read text to tell the date but uses funny emoticons to spell the name of the movie. Deadpool, using a skull to say dead, a poo to say poo and an l to finish the word.
